ESSENDON will give veteran Dustin Fletcher a 36th birthday present by permanently naming an end of Etihad Stadium in his honour.
Starting today against the West Coast Eagles, the Lockett End will revert to the Fletcher End for Bomber games.
Fletcher, who celebrated his birthday yesterday, has played 333 games in 19 seasons since being drafted in 1992 as a father/son selection.
"He's an amazing player with a natural athletic ability who I would rate as one of the greatest players in the game," declared former great and now coach James Hird.
Fletcher beat greats Dick Reynolds, Bill Hutchison and Terry Daniher in a poll of more than 10,000 Essendon website votes to be opposite the Lloyd End.
